Address 0 PPC

PGHeLhkJXR99qbsiiUJnqqd1EXnDbbcNvW

Confirmed

Total Received140.61906 PPC
Total Sent140.61906 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PGHeLhkJXR99qbsiiUJnqqd1EXnDbbcNvW140.61906 PPC
Fee: 0.01 PPC
609193 Confirmations140.60906 PPC
PGHeLhkJXR99qbsiiUJnqqd1EXnDbbcNvW140.61906 PPC
PLZxurpDpzT3Y5LPvYUHXAjgo7MnaBfvD6135.628 PPC
Fee: 0.01 PPC
609194 Confirmations276.24706 PPC